pattheriault wrote:When I press the button to set the cruise on. it take like a second or two to come on so my speed drop like 5 or 10 KM/H and when it does get on my speed raise back to where I did hit the button..

is that normal on these car? if not what could be causing this?
The cruise is vacuum run so it's normal. If it were electronic then the response would be a bit quicker. The cruise system takes time to create that cable tension using vacuum pressure.

I just rebuilt my CC module, and I noticed that after conditioning and cleaning the rubber inside, it still takes a second to engage, but it is less noticeable then before. If you're is taking 3 seconds to engage, check wires, clean the pinouts by the module or rebuild the module, its free unless something is broken, just needs cleaning inside!
